Count numbers between (a,b) with no consecutive ones in binary representation.
Use dynamic programming to count numbers with no consecutive ones.
Calculate count of numbers with no consecutive ones up to b and a-1.
Subtract the counts to get the final answer.

Find the lighter ball among 9 balls in 2 weightings using a balance.
Divide the balls into 3 groups of 3 each.
Weigh any 2 groups against each other.
If they balance, the lighter ball is in the third group.
If they don't balance, the lighter ball is in the lighter group.
Take 2 balls from the lighter group and weigh them against each other.
If they balance, the lighter ball is the remaining one.

To serialize and deserialize a tree, use a recursive approach to traverse the tree and store the data in a suitable format.
Use pre-order traversal to serialize the tree by storing the node values in a list or string.
For deserialization, reconstruct the tree by recursively building nodes from the serialized data.
Consider using JSON or XML format for serialization to easily store and retrieve tree structure.

A promise is a commitment to do something in the future, typically used for asynchronous operations in JavaScript.
Promises are used to handle asynchronous operations in JavaScript.
They represent a value that may be available now, in the future, or never.
Promises have three states: pending, fulfilled, or rejected.
Example: new Promise((resolve, reject) => { setTimeout(() => resolve('Done!'), 1000); });
Event loop is a mechanism that allows for asynchronous execution of code by managing the order of events in a single thread.
Event loop continuously checks the call stack for any functions that need to be executed, and processes them in a non-blocking manner.
Different types of queues in event loop include microtask queue (Promise callbacks), macrotask queue (setTimeout, setInterval callbacks), and animation frame queue
